1970's Luke Cage: So Sweet, it's Christmas!
Back in the ancient days, I remember when Luke Cage: Hero for Hire premiered to great fanfare. That was the time when films like Shaft and Superfly (which I could not see as they were rated R) were popular. I loved this house ad drawing by John Romita that Stan Lee highlighted in his soapbox.
I really dig the fact that the 1970s version of Luke Cage came out of that Skrull spaceship in Secret Invasion #1. I'm halfway hoping that this is the real deal and the Luke that married Jessica is the Skrull. I know that is impossible...but I can't stop fantasizing. Nuff said.
